A GANDHARA GREY SCHIST RELIEF FRAGMENT, NORTH-WEST FRONTIER REGION, PAKISTAN, 3RD / 4TH CENTURY - depicting
two Buddhist devotees, with hands in anjali mudra, wearing voluminous robes, one wearing a turban, the hand of a further figure behind, mounted, - 34.5cm high - Provenance: Private Collection, London
